Description:
As an Inventory Control Mover 1 (ICM1), you will be responsible for the receipt, administration, control and management of inventory of raw and packaging materials. You will use a powered industrial truck (PIT) to perform all inventory moves. You will provide input to all data related to items purchased and used by the company.
